在2D地图中投影EPSG:4326数据?


13

我想认为我比较精通基准面,投影和坐标参考系。

OpenStreetMap数据存储在WGS84纬度/经度(EPSG:4326)中。此CRS具有地理意义,因此旨在将位置存储在3D地球上。当我看到这张地图时,我在看什么?

看着雷克雅未克,看来经线趋向于格林那子午线的北极(或者也许他们以透视图计划了这座城市?),所以我假设0,90是地图的顶部中心。

这堂课是不是一个投影?如果是,那是投影?

是否有一个通常用于纬度/经度数据的投影?

我使用EPSG:4326将数据存储在Oracle中,当由GeoServer渲染而没有指定投影时,它也显示这些特征。


我实际上想知道最近是否完全一样。它不仅适用于OSM,而且适用于任何GIS软件...当ArcGIS,Qgis显示非投影数据时,它们会做什么?我们在看什么?我的猜测(但随时可以纠正)是他们不在乎!它们显示坐标,就好像它们是笛卡尔参考系统一样。在地球上,子午线正在向两极汇聚,这也反映在雷克雅未克向东北方向扭曲的事实。现在,如果这是正确的,是否可以将其视为隐式投影?如果是,那将是哪种类型的投影?
斯特凡Henriod

您是否注意到坐标显示在右下角向下?快速浏览一下即可轻松解决您的问题。
ub

@whuber我看到了坐标读数,但是并没有真正的作用-如果不在显示屏上加上纬度和经度线,数字只会使我对位置如何映射到图像的概念模糊,而不能直接解释为什么北或南部城市倾向于以市中心为中心
tomfumb 2012年

1
在地理坐标参考系统中显示数据时,ArcGIS软件会将纬度/经度视为2D直角坐标值。Plate Carree通过将纬度/经度值转换为弧度并乘以半长轴来缩放纬度/经度值。我说例如ArcMap使用伪板Carree投影。
mkennedy 2012年

Answers:


16

OpenLayers使用术语 “ EPSG:4326”来表示Plate Caree投影。长期以来,将“ WGS84”和EPSG:4326称为投影是一个令人困惑的根源。自从Google和OpenLayers出现之前,这种简写就一直存在。例如,据我所知,ESRI一直在混淆这些术语。除非事先告知,否则OpenLayers不会立即将其投影到EPSG:900913,如果您想将数据与Google基本地图混合,则必须这样做,因为Google API仅使用900913(这是Google发明的-隐约让人想起数字'google')。


哈哈!找到了。Christopher Schmidt首先建议使用900913。crschmidt.net/blog/archives/243/google-projection-900913
mkennedy 2012年

事实证明这是不正确的。EPSG:4326既定义了使用WGS84的基准,又定义了LongLat / Plate Caree投影。参见spatialreference.org/ref/epsg/4326/proj4js
乍得

不完全的。WGS84是用于投影和基准的名称(相同的名称,但有两个不同的地方)。EPSG:4326只是用于投影的EPSG代码,通常称为“ WGS84”,它也使用WGS84基准面(请参见EPSG官方网站),因此答案是正确的
MappaGnosis

2

EPSG:4326不是一个预测;它是“未投影的”。雷克雅未克的确与基本方向成一定角度:http : //osm.org/go/e0UtZkUl-,当您查看链接的地图时,您会看到经度和纬度线映射到360:2矩形°宽180°高。顶部和底部边缘都是地球表面(北极和南极)上的点。

在网络上,用于纬度/经度数据的常见投影是EPSG:900913(或正式为3857),即Google球形网络墨卡托投影。这主要是过去几年中通过网络地图无处不在的这种预测。


2
在Web地图之前,因此在创建EPSG:900913之前,这种投影已经很长时间了。EPSG:900913使用与EPSG:4326不同的基准(确切地说,前者使用理想球体,后者使用扁球形球体)
MappaGnosis 2012年

抱歉,我的问题应该更具体:我不是在问4326是投影,而是我正在查看的地图是否正在使用投影显示4326数据。我知道这张特定的地图没有使用球形墨卡托,因为我习惯于看到雷克雅未克没有视觉偏斜
tomfumb 2012年

3
为了回应您的评论tomfumb,说您正在查看的地图正在使用转换可能更准确。投影通常是三角函数,旨在保留地理的某些方面优先于其他方面:相等的面积,保形形状,罗盘方位等。变换是将一组坐标移动到给定视图中的线性函数,例如通过相加来移动上下左右或乘法以使360°适合600像素。
Michal Migurski 2012年

5
您做出了有用的区分,但是您的术语是非常规的。您的“变换”通常称为“仿射变换”,以将其与更一般的数学变换感区分开。同样,三角函数实际上没有给出任何投影(尽管这样的函数可能是过程的一部分)。因此,实际上,Sylvester Sneekly将这个地图标识为使用Plate Carree投影是正确的,即使该投影根本不涉及任何触发。这不是仿射变换。该概念仅适用于欧几里得空间(图)。
ub
By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.